The Apple MacBook Pro 16 is more expensive and offers a sleek design with high build quality. It is optimized for programmers, designers, and general use, with an extended battery life and a brilliant display suitable for color-sensitive work. It isn't designed for intensive gaming, despite good general and engineering performance. The MSI Raider GE77Hx, while less expensive, excels in gaming with its powerful graphics card and high-refresh-rate screen but is heavier and has a shorter battery life, making it less portable. It is also well-suited for engineering and 3D tasks, but the design might not appeal to professionals in a corporate setting. Choose the MacBook Pro for premium build and display with longer battery life for general and professional use, or the Raider for better gaming, 3D work, and cost savings at the expense of portability and battery life. The MSI Raider GE77Hx is very good for gaming and AI, while the Apple MacBook Pro 16 (Late 2023) is good.
The Apple MacBook Pro 16 (Late 2023) is recognized for its good 3D capabilities, thanks to its Apple M3 Pro GPU, suitable for rendering and creative work, but it is limited by macOS's compatibility with popular games, compared to Windows. On the other hand, the MSI Raider GE77Hx boasts a high-performance Nvidia RTX 3070 Ti GPU and a higher screen refresh rate, making it very good for gaming responsiveness and rendering tasks, while also offering broader game compatibility with Windows 11 Pro.

The Apple MacBook Pro 16 has a better screen than the MSI Raider GE77Hx for general use, engineering and design, software development, and content creation.
The Apple MacBook Pro 16's vibrant and high-resolution display offers exceptional color accuracy crucial for engineering and design work and remains comfortably viewable in various lighting conditions for general use, but its standard refresh rate is less optimal for 3D applications that demand quicker screen updates for smooth visuals. The MSI Raider GE77Hx provides a similarly high-resolution screen with a decent color range for precise visual work and everyday tasks, yet the screen doesn't refresh as quickly as dedicated gaming models which is a drawback for action-packed 3D gaming and rendering. Essentially, the MacBook excels in visual quality and color representation but falls short for high-speed 3D graphics, while the MSI stands out for general and design tasks but isn't the best choice for gamers who prioritize refresh rate.

"The Apple MacBook Pro 16 2023: M2 Max challenges GeForce RTX 3080 Ti. The new MacBook Pro 16 2023 with the M2 Max SoC is the most powerful laptop Apple has on sale right now. While we do not get the expected performance and efficiency improvements from completely new 3 nm chips, which we expected ahead of the launch, the 2023 model is still a solid update. The CPU of the M2 Max can be up to 20 % faster than the old model and we also see an advantage of 25-30 % for the GPU with 38 cores. However, both components also consume more power, so the efficiency did not change that much under maximum load."
"The MSI Raider GE77 offers a lot of power for a lot of money. The main components consist of a Core i9-12900HX CPU, a GeForce RTX 3080 Ti Laptop GPU (175 watts TGP, 16 GB VRAM), and 64 GB of RAM, which makes for a high overall performance level. The GeForce GPU in particular scores some of the highest scores we have seen from this chip. Both the CPU and the GPU are able to run at continuously high clock speeds. The relatively high heat and noise emissions match our expectations for this device class. With approximately 5.5 to 6.5 hours, the battery life is good for a powerful 4K laptop."

About MSI
MSI, also known as Micro-Star International, is a Taiwanese technology corporation. MSI is known for their wide range of gaming devices. Their series include the entry-level Cyborg/Thin and Sword/Katana series, the mid-range Bravo/Delta and Crosshair/Pulse series, and their high-end Vector, Raider, Stealth, and Titan GT series. At every performance level, MSI offers a variety of devices with varying balances between performance, battery life, weight, and price, making them a solid option to consider at every price point.
